TUMPAT – A horrifying family dispute erupted into murder on Friday night in Kampung Kok Bedollah when Mohd Suhairi Hasim, 46, a crane driver and father of two, was brutally hacked to death by his own cousin. The attack stemmed from the suspect’s accusation that Suhairi had infected his child, possibly with a contagious illness.
Elderly mother Wan Salma Wan Said, 68, was preparing for bed around 11 p.m. when she heard her son’s desperate cries of “ALLAH… ALLAH…” echoing over 20 times from outside. Rushing to the window, she called out, “Who are you fighting with now, Hairi?” but received no reply. Alarmed, she hurried to the spot near their home where Suhairi was washing his crane.

In the pitch-black night, her blurred vision initially tricked her into thinking the shadowy figure was her son. But it was the cousin. “The suspect was not far from Hairi (the victim), who was already lying on the ground covered in blood, and told me that he had attacked my son out of anger over matters involving his child.”
She screamed for nearby relatives to help. His body was rushed to Tumpat Hospital for a post-mortem and later buried at the local Muslim cemetery.
Tumpat police chief Assistant Commissioner Mohd Khairi Shafie confirmed the arrest of the 40-something suspect, who tested positive for drugs and was remanded for seven days in Pasir Mas Court for further investigation.
